Preparing the Dough for Flourless Peanut Butter Banana Oatmeal Cookies

Preparing the dough for flourless peanut butter banana oatmeal cookies is quick and easy. You will only need a few basic ingredients, which you probably already have in your pantry. This recipe calls for ripe bananas, creamy peanut butter, old-fashioned oats, honey, vanilla extract, baking powder, and a pinch of salt.

To start, pre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per. In a mixing bowl, mash two ripe bananas until smooth. Add half a cup of creamy peanut butter, one and a half cups of old-fashioned oats, two tablespoons of honey, one teaspoon of vanilla extract, half a teaspoon of baking powder, and a pinch of salt. Stir well until all the ingredients are thoroughly combined.

Once the dough is ready, you can use a cookie scoop or a spoon to portion out the dough onto the prepared baking sheet. Leave some space between each cookie as they will spread slightly during baking. This recipe typically yields about 12 cookies.

Bake the cookies in the preheated oven for 10 to 12 minutes or until they are lightly golden brown around the edges. Be sure not to overbake them as they can become dry. After removing them from the oven, allow the cookies to cool on the baking sheet for a few min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ely.

Baking and Cooling Techniques for Perfect Results

When it comes to baking and cooling flourless peanut butter banana oatmeal cookies, there are a few techniques you can follow to achieve perfect results. Firstly, make sure to preheat your oven properly and use an accurate oven thermometer to ensure the right temperature.

While baking, check on the cookies around the 10-minute mark to prevent overbaking. The cookies should be lightly golden brown on the edges and slightly soft in the center. If they still appear doughy, bake them for an additional minute or two, keeping a close eye on them to avoid burning.

After baking, it’s crucial to let the cookies cool properly to maintain their texture and prevent them from crumbling. Allow the cookies to cool on the baking sheet for a few minutes before transferring them to a wire rack. Once on the wire rack, let them cool completely before enjoying.

For optimum freshness and texture, store the cooled cookies in an airtight container. They can be kept at room temperature for up to three days, or in the refrigerator for up to one week.

Variations and Additions to Make the Recipe Your Own

While the basic recipe for flourless peanut butter banana oatmeal cookies is delicious on its own, there are various variations and additions you can incorporate to make the recipe more personalized and unique. Here are a few ideas:

  • Additions: Consider adding chocolate chips, chopped nuts, raisins, or dried cranberries to the cookie dough. These additions will add extra flavor and texture to the cookies.
  • Spices: Experiment with adding spices such as cinnamon, nutmeg, or cardamom to enhance the taste of the cookies. These spices can complement the flavors of peanut butter and banana beautifully.
  • Drizzle: After the cookies have cooled, you can drizzle them with melted chocolate or a peanut butter glaze for an extra indulgent touch.
  • Sandwich: Create a delightful sandwich cookie by spreading a layer of peanut butter or Nutella between two cookies. This variation adds another element of decadence to the treat.

Feel free to get creative and customize the recipe according to your preferences. The possibilities are endless!

Frequently Asked Questions

Here are some frequently asked questions about flourless peanut butter banana oatmeal cookies:

No. Questions Answers
1 Can I use regular peanut butter instead of natural peanut butter? Yes, you can use regular peanut butter in this recipe. However, keep in mind that natural peanut butter without added sugar or oil is usually a healthier option.
2 Can I substitute honey with another sweetener? Yes, you can substitute honey with maple syrup or agave nectar. Just make sure to adjust the quantity accordingly.
3 Can I use regular oats instead of quick oats? Yes, you can use regular oats instead of quick oats in this recipe. The texture may be slightly different, but the cookies will still turn out delicious.
4 Can I omit the chocolate chips? Yes, you can omit the chocolate chips if you prefer. The cookies will still be tasty with the peanut butter and banana flavors.
5 How should I store these cookies? You can store these cookies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 5 days. They also freeze well for longer storage.
6 Can I add nuts or dried fruits to the recipe? Absolutely! Feel free to add chopped nuts, such as almonds or walnuts, or dried fruits, such as raisins or cranberries, to the cookie dough for extra texture and flavor.

Flourless Peanut Butter Banana Oatmeal Cookies

Learn how to make delicious flourless peanut butter banana oatmeal cookies. These cookies are a perfect combination of healthy ingredients and mouthwatering flavors.

  • 1 cup natural peanut butter
  • 2 ripe bananas (mashed)
  • 1/4 cup honey
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 2 cups quick oats
  • 1/2 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1/4 cup chocolate chips
  1. Step 1: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  2. Step 2: In a large bowl, mix together the peanut butter, mashed bananas, honey, and vanilla extract until well combined.
  3. Step 3: Add the quick oats and baking soda to the bowl, and stir until all ingredients are evenly incorporated.
  4. Step 4: Fold in the chocolate chips.
  5. Step 5: Drop rounded spoonfuls of dough onto the prepared baking sheet, spacing them about 2 inches apart.
  6. Step 6: Bake for 10-12 minutes, or until the edges are golden brown.
  7. Step 7: Remove from the oven and let the cookies cool on the baking sheet for 5 minutes. Transfer to a wire rack to cool completely.
